Abstract
Emotional disarray linked to interventional procedures may potentially aggravate previous psychiatric conditions or even precipitate new psychopathologies. Despite of the well-known deleterious impact of mental health disorders on cardiac outcomes, psychological disturbances are relatively understudied yet of vital importance to the overall health of post-pacing patients. In this case series we present a spectrum of mental illnesses observed in a cohort of patients who underwent permanent pacemaker implantation in Tanzania's national referral cardiac centre. Five individuals of African origin aged between 58 and 81 years presented to Jakaya Kikwete Cardiac Institute with clinical conditions warranting permanent pacemaker implantation. All five denied prior history of mental illness, however, after thorough psychiatric reviews; organic brain syndrome, panic disorder, brief psychotic disorder, adjustment disorder and major depressive disorder diagnoses were reached. All five were successfully channeled for medical psychotherapy. To conclude, this case series illustrates variable consequences of poor psychological adaptation to implantable cardiac devices, and it underscores the importance of continued psychological evaluation to such patients.

Abstract
Background Genetic heart diseases (GHDs) can be clinically heterogeneous and pose an increased risk of sudden cardiac death (SCD). The implantable cardioverter-defibrillator (ICD) is a lifesaving therapy. Impacts on prospective and long-term psychological and health-related quality of life (HR-QoL) after ICD implant in patients with GHDs are unknown. Objectives Investigate the psychological functioning and HR-QoL over time in patients with GHDs who receive an ICD, and identify risk factors for poor psychological functioning and HR-QoL. Methods A longitudinal, prospective study design was used. Patients attending a specialized clinic, diagnosed with a GHD for which they received an ICD between May 2012 and January 2015, were eligible. Baseline surveys were completed prior to ICD implantation with 5-year follow-up after ICD implant. We measured psychological functioning (Hospital Anxiety Depression Scale, Florida Shock Anxiety Scale), HR-QoL (Short-Form 36v2), and device acceptance (Florida Patient Acceptance Scale). Results Forty patients were included (mean age 46.3 ± 14.2 years; 65.0% male). Mean psychological and HR-QoL measures were within normative ranges during follow-up. After 12 months, 33.3% and 19.4% of participants showed clinically elevated levels of anxiety and depression, respectively. Longitudinal mixed-effect analysis showed significant improvements from baseline to first follow-up for the overall cohort, with variability increasing after 36 months. Nontertiary education and female sex predicted worse mental HR-QoL and anxiety over time, while comorbidities predicted depression and worse physical HR-QoL. Conclusion While the majority of patients with a GHD adjust well to their ICD implant, a subset of patients experience poor psychological and HR-QoL outcomes.

Abstract
Patients with pacemakers need regular follow-ups which are demanding. Telemonitoring for pacemaker can provide a new opportunity to avoid follow-up visits. On the other hand, in-person visits could help patients with pacemakers to cope better with the anxiety linked to their condition and maintain better communication with their doctors than simple remote control of their device status. Therefore, our objective was to analyze the experiences and communication comparing telemonitoring (TM) versus conventional monitoring (CM) of patients with pacemakers. A single-center, controlled, non-randomized, non-blinded clinical trial was designed. Data were collected five years after implantation in a cohort of 89 consecutive patients assigned to two different groups: TM and CM. The ‘Generic Short Patient Experiences Questionnaire’ (GS-PEQ) was used to assess patients’ experiences, and the Healthcare Communication Questionnaire (HCCQ) was used to measure the communication of patients with healthcare professionals. Additionally, an ad-hoc survey including items from the ‘Telehealth Patient Satisfaction Survey’ and a ‘costs survey’ was used. After five years, 55 patients completed the study (TM = 21; CM = 34). Participants’ mean (±SD) age was 81 (±6.47), and 31% were females. No differences in baseline characteristics between groups were found. The comparative analyses TM versus CM showed some significant differences. According to GS-PEQ, TM users received adequate information about their diagnosis or afflictions (p = .035) and the treatment was better adapted to their situation (p = .009). Both groups reported negative experiences regarding their involvement in their treatment decisions, the waiting time before admission, and perceived a low-benefit. According to HCCQ, the TM group experienced poorer consultation management by the healthcare provider (p = .041). Participants reported positive overall communication experiences. The study provides insights into the experiences and communication in PM monitoring services as well as specific areas where users reported negative experiences such as the consultation management by clinicians. Abstract
Cardiac rehabilitation (CR) is a multidisciplinary intervention including patient assessment and medical actions to promote stabilization, management of cardiovascular risk factors, vocational support, psychosocial management, physical activity counselling, and prescription of exercise training. Millions of people with cardiac implantable electronic devices live in Europe and their numbers are progressively increasing, therefore, large subsets of patients admitted in CR facilities have a cardiac implantable electronic device. Patients who are cardiac implantable electronic devices recipients are considered eligible for a CR programme. This is not only related to the underlying heart disease but also to specific issues, such as psychological adaptation to living with an implanted device and, in implantable cardioverter-defibrillator patients, the risk of arrhythmia, syncope, and sudden cardiac death. Therefore, these patients should receive special attention, as their needs may differ from other patients participating in CR. As evidence from studies of CR in patients with cardiac implantable electronic devices is sparse, detailed clinical practice guidelines are lacking. Here, we aim to provide practical recommendations for CR in cardiac implantable electronic devices recipients in order to increase CR implementation, efficacy, and safety in this subset of patients.

Abstract
INTRODUCTION Anxiety and depression among implantable cardioverter-defibrillator (ICD) recipients can lead to physical or psychological consequences and reduce the quality of life of these patients. Few studies have compared the frequency and severity of depressive and anxiety disorders in the pacemaker (PM) and ICD recipients. The aim of the present study was to compare depression and anxiety among PM and ICD recipients. METHODS This cross-sectional study was performed on 296 patients referred to a specialized cardiology teaching hospital from October 1, 2019 to July 1, 2020. Patients were selected using convenience sampling method. RESULTS Regarding anxiety, the results showed that the overall prevalence of anxiety in PM, ICD, and control groups was 23.5%, 28%, and 8%, respectively. Results showed no significant difference between PM and ICD recipients regarding the anxiety prevalence (p = .46). With regard to depression, the results showed that the overall prevalence of depression in the PM, ICD, and control groups was 7.1%, 23%, and 4.1%, respectively. The results showed a significant difference between PM and ICD recipients in terms of depression prevalence (p = .03). The results also showed that the prevalence of depression was significantly higher among PM and ICD recipients than the control group (p = .01). CONCLUSION Considering the results of the present study and the high prevalence of anxiety and depression, it seems necessary to focus more on educating patients about the effectiveness of PM and ICD devices in reducing anxiety and depression.

Abstract
INTRODUCTION The implantation of a pacemaker or an implantable cardioverter-defibrillator during childhood may reduce quality of life and lead to mental health problems. This study aimed to evaluate potential mental health problems (i.e., depressive and anxiety symptoms) and quality of life in children with cardiac active devices in comparison to healthy peers. METHODS We analysed data of children with pacemakers or implantable cardioverter-defibrillators aged 6-18 years. Quality of life, depressive and anxiety symptoms were assessed by standardised questionnaires. The results were compared to age-matched reference groups. RESULTS Children with implantable cardioverter-defibrillator showed significant lower quality of life in comparison to reference group (p = 0.03), but there was no difference in quality of life between children with pacemaker and reference group. There was no significant difference in depressive symptoms between children with a cardiac rhythm device compared to reference group (self-report: p = 0.67; proxy report: p = 0.49). There was no significant difference in anxiety (p = 0.53) and depressive symptoms (p = 0.86) between children with pacemaker and children with implantable cardioverter-defibrillator. CONCLUSIONS Living with an implantable cardioverter-defibrillator in childhood seems to decrease the patients' quality of life. Although children with pacemaker and implantable cardioverter-defibrillator don't seem to show more depressive and anxiety symptoms in comparison to their healthy peers, there still can be an increased risk for those children to develop mental health problems. Therefore, treating physicians should be aware of potential mental health problems and provide the patients and their families with appropriate therapeutic offers.

Abstract
As the global population ages, cardiac pacing procedures are rising exponentially to keep pace with the increasing incidence of bradyarrhythmias. The efficacy of pacemakers is well established, but recipients may have poor psychosocial adaptation leading to development or exacerbation of mental disorders, that may manifest with anxiety, depressive symptoms or rarely suicidal tendencies. An 83-year-old male of African descent was referred to us for evaluation and expert management. He came with chief complaints of general body malaise, light-headedness, chest pain and fainting spells for about 6 months. He was diagnosed with hypertension 4 years prior, and there was no history of mental illness in the patient or his family. Echocardiography (ECHO) revealed features of hypertensive heart disease while electrocardiogram (ECG) showed features of third-degree heart block. He underwent successful pacing with a resultant ventricular paced rhythm. The patient was stable and symptom free post pacing, but on the fourth day he jumped off the window of the ward in the hospital’s second floor. Post suicide attempt examination revealed epistaxis, right periorbital hematoma with a temporal lacerated wound and deformed ankles bilaterally. ECG showed a ventricular paced rhythm and the chest radiograph showed an intact pacemaker. Ophthalmological review was evident for right sided blepharospasm with massive chemosis and bilateral constricted reactive pupils. Radiological investigations showed right orbital fracture, stable C5 and C6 fractures, and bilateral bimalleolar fractures with ankle dislocation. Neurosurgical review was unremarkable and psychiatric review could not be performed. The patient died 18 h after the suicide attempt incidence. Emotional disturbances post pacing impairs the quality of life and in the worst case scenario could lead to unanticipated cessation of life. In view of this, thorough evaluation and monitoring of the patient’s psychological well-being both pre and post pacing is paramount.

Abstract
BACKGROUND Cardiac implantable electronic devices (CIEDs) are widely used to treat bradyarrhythmias or improve the prognosis of patients with heart failure (HF). AIMS To evaluate age-related (≤ 75 vs. > 75 years) attitudes, worries, psychological effects and needs in an Italian CIEDs population. METHODS Patients attending their periodical ambulatory evaluation received a questionnaire conceived by the European Heart Rhythm Association Scientific Initiatives Committee as part of a multicenter, multinational snapshot survey. Seven countries participated in the study, and 1646 replies were collected. Of these, 437 (27%) were from Italy. Present results refer to the Italian population only. CIEDs were stratified into devices to treat bradycardia or HF. RESULTS The use of CIEDs was more common in advanced age. Older patients needed less information about CIEDs than younger ones (p = 0.044), who would prefer to be better informed about CIEDs-related consequences on psychologic profile (p = 0.045), physical (p < 0.001) and sexual (p < 0.001) activities, and driving limitations (p = 0.003). When compared to older subjects, younger individuals experienced more difficulties (p = 0.035), especially in their professional (p < 0.001) and private life (p = 0.033), feeling their existence was limited by the device (p < 0.001). Conversely, quality of life (HRQL) more often improved in the elderly (p = 0.001). Information about what to do with CIEDs at the end of life is scant independently of age. CONCLUSIONS HRQL after CIEDs implantation improves more frequently in older patients, while the psychological burden of CIEDs is usually higher in younger patients. End of life issues are seldom discussed.

Abstract
BACKGROUND The concept of 'patient experience' has become central to how to improve healthcare. Remote communication with patients is today a frequent practice in healthcare services, showing similar outcomes to standard outpatient care while enabling cost reduction in both formal and informal care. The purpose of this study was to analyse the experiences of people with telemonitoring pacemakers. METHODS Patients were randomly allocated to either the telemonitoring or hospital monitoring follow-ups. Using the 'Generic Short Patient Experiences Questionnaire' (GS-PEQ), as well as an ad-hoc survey from the 'telehealth patient satisfaction survey' and 'costs survey', patients' experiences were measured six months after the pacemaker implant in a cohort of 50 consecutive patients. The mean age was 74.8 (± 11.75) years and 26 (52%) patients were male of which 1 was lost in follow-up. Finally, 24 patients were followed up with standard hospital monitoring, while 25 used the telemonitoring system. Differences in baseline characteristics between groups were not found. RESULTS Findings showed overall positive and similar experiences in patients living with telemonitoring and hospital monitoring pacemakers. Significant differences were found in GS-PEQ concerning how telemonitoring patients received less information about their diagnosis/afflictions (p = 0.046). We did not find significant differences in other items such as 'confidence in the clinicians' professional skills', 'treatment perception adapted to their situation', 'involvement in decisions regarding the treatment', 'perception of hospital organisation', 'waiting before admission', 'satisfaction of help and treatment received', 'benefit received', and 'incorrect treatment'. CONCLUSIONS The remote communication of pacemakers was met with positive levels of patients' experiences similarly to patients in the hospital monitoring follow-up. However, telemonitoring patients received less information. Thus, improving the quality and timing of information is required in telemonitoring patients in the planning and organisation of future remote communication healthcare services for people living with a pacemaker implant.

Abstract
BACKGROUND This study assessed anxiety and depression in children with permanent pacemakers (PPM) and quality of life of their parents. METHODS Ninety children (63.3% males and 36.6% females) and their parents were included in the study and were divided into three groups. The control group (Group 1) included 30 normal healthy children (57% males and 43% females), the PPM group (Group 2) included 30 age-matched children (70% males and 30% females) with PPM and structurally normal heart, while the Group 3 included 30 children (63% males and 37% females) with PPM and congenital heart disease (PPM+CHD). Psychological assessment of children and their parents was carried out using an interview-based questionnaires. RESULTS Psychiatric disorders were more prevalent in PPM+CHD group including depression (P=0.04), anxiety (P=0.02) and lower parents' QoL (P=0.01). The PPM group had higher depression and lower parents' QoL than the control group. Family income was independent factor for depression (r2=-6.3, with P<0.05). Sex of the child and CCU admission were independent factors for anxiety (r2=-9.5, P<0.05 & r2=10.5, P=0.001) in PPM group. CONCLUSION Children with pacemakers have higher psychiatric disorders and their parents have lower QoL.

Abstract
Despite the indisputable mortality advantages of implantable cardioverter defibrillators (ICDs), no consensus exists regarding their impact on quality of life (QoL). This systematic review investigates differences in QoL between patients with ICDs and controls. We systematically searched the MEDLINE, EMBASE, Cochrane, Web of Science, and PsychINFO databases. Articles were included if they were published after the year 2000 and reported on original studies with a control group. Five randomized controlled trials with a total of 5,138 patients and 10 observational studies with a total of 1,513 patients met the inclusion criteria. Nine studies found comparable QoL for ICD recipients and patients in the control groups, three studies found an increased QoL for ICD patients, and three studies found a decreased QoL for ICD patients. The question of whether QoL relates to ICD therapy cannot be answered conclusively due to the heterogeneity of the existing studies. Lower QoL was apparent among patients with an ICD who experienced several device discharges. Medical staff should be particularly aware of the signs of both psychological and physical disorders in these patients. Further investigations on QoL in ICD patients are desirable, but ethical reasons restrict the conduct of randomized trials.

Abstract
BACKGROUND Less is known about depression, anxiety and quality of life (QoL) in children and adolescents with pacemakers (PMs) and implantable cardioverter-defibrillators (ICDs) than is known in adults with these devices. METHODS A standardized psychiatric interview diagnosed anxiety/depressive disorders in a cross-sectional study. Self-report measures of anxiety, depression and post-traumatic stress disorder were obtained. Medical disease severity, family functioning and QoL data were collected. A total of 166 patients were enrolled (52 ICD, 114 PM; median age 15 years). RESULTS Prevalence of current and lifetime psychiatric disorders was higher in patients with ICDs than PMs (Current: 27% vs. 11%, P = .02; Lifetime: 52% ICD vs. 34% PM, P = .01). Patients with ICDs had more anxiety than a healthy population (25% vs. 7%, P < .01). Patients with ICDs and PMs had similar levels of depression as a healthy population (ICD 10%, PM 4%, reference 4%, P = .29). In multivariate analysis including a medical disease score, demographics, exposure to beta-blockers, activity limitations, hospitalizations, shocks and procedures, the type of device (PM versus ICD) did not predict psychiatric diagnoses when age at implantation and the severity of medical disease were controlled for. Patients with ICDs and PMs had lower physical QoL scores (ICD 45, PM 47.5, Norm 53, P ≤ .03), but similar psychosocial functioning scores (ICD 49, PM 51, Norm 51, P ≥ .16) versus a normal reference population. CONCLUSIONS Anxiety is highly prevalent in young patients with ICDs, but the higher rates can be attributed to medical disease severity and age at implantation instead of type of device.

Abstract
OBJECTIVE To systematically review the literature with regard to psychiatric disorders and quality of life in patients with an implantable cardioverter defibrillator. DATA SOURCES Research was conducted in 3 databases (ISI Web of Science, PubMed, and PsycINFO) using the terms implantable, cardioverter, defibrillator, quality of life, psych *, anxiety, and depression. STUDY SELECTION The search yielded 1,399 references. Non-English and repeated references were excluded. After abstract analysis, 42 references were recovered for full-text reading, and 25 articles were selected for this review. DATA EXTRACTION Research took place in April 2012, and no time restriction was placed on any of the database searches. Review or theoretical articles were excluded, and only clinical trials and epidemiologic studies were selected for this review. RESULTS A systematic review of the literature revealed mostly observational prospective cohort studies followed by cross-sectional observational studies and randomized clinical trials. Few studies included in the review were observational retrospective cohort or case-control studies. There are prominent signs and symptoms of anxiety and depression in patients with an implantable cardioverter defibrillator. Disorders include phobic anxiety, posttraumatic stress disorder, panic disorder, somatoform disorder, agoraphobia, and depression. Quality of life in the physical, social, and psychological domains is affected and is related to the intensity and the frequency of the device's electrical discharge. CONCLUSIONS Work regarding psychiatric comorbidity in patients with an implantable cardioverter defibrillator has shown that anxiety and depression are common. The patients and their families should be informed by their doctors that the presence of the device minimizes risk of sudden death and allows them to have a normal life.

Abstract
OBJECTIVES To examine the temporal contingency of anxiety and implantable cardioverter defibrillator (ICD) therapy (anti-tachycardia-pacing and shocks to prevent ventricular tachycardia and/or fibrillation). BACKGROUND It is under debate whether anxiety is a precursor and/or consequence of ICD-therapy. METHODS In a prospective longitudinal study, fifty-four patients undergoing first-time ICD-implantation were assessed for anxiety, frequency of ICD-shocks and anti-tachycardia-pacing up to two days before ICD-implantation (T0) and twelve months later (T1). RESULTS Anxiety at T0 did not predict frequency of ICD-shocks at T1, but ICD-shocks significantly predicted increased anxiety at T1. In contrast, anxiety at T0 and T1 was unrelated to frequency of anti-tachycardia-pacing. Effects remained stable when we controlled for potentially confounding variables (e.g. age, sex, cardiac health and depression at T0). CONCLUSION Our findings indicate that repeated ICD-shocks are a cause of anxiety in ICD-patients rather than a consequence, thus shock frequency should be minimized.

Abstract
OBJECTIVE The implantable cardioverter defibrillator (ICD) is used to treat life-threatening ventricular arrhythmias and in the prevention of sudden cardiac death. A significant proportion of ICD patients experience psychological symptoms including anxiety, depression or both, which in turn can impact adjustment to the device. The objective of this systematic review was to assess the prevalence of anxiety and depression or symptoms of anxiety and depression among adults with ICDs. METHODS Search of MEDLINE®, CINAHL®, PsycINFO®, EMBASE® and Cochrane® for English-language articles published through 2009 that used validated diagnostic interviews to diagnose anxiety or depression or self-report questionnaires to assess symptoms of anxiety or depression in adults with an ICD. RESULTS Forty-five studies that assessed over 5000 patients were included. Between 11% and 28% of patients had a depressive disorder and 11-26% had an anxiety disorder in 3 small studies (Ns=35-90) that used validated diagnostic interviews. Rates of elevated symptoms of anxiety (8-63%) and depression (5-41%) based on self-report questionnaires ranged widely across studies and times of assessment. Evidence was inconsistent on rates pre- versus post-implantation, rates over time, rates for primary versus secondary prevention, and for shocked versus non-shocked patients. CONCLUSION Larger studies utilizing structured interviews are needed to determine the prevalence of anxiety and depression among ICD patients and factors that may influence rates of anxiety and depressive disorders. Based on existing data, it may be appropriate to assume a 20% prevalence rate for both depressive and anxiety disorders post-ICD implant, a rate similar to that in other cardiac populations.

Abstract
BACKGROUND Among older adults, implantable cardioverter-defibrillator (ICD) use is increasing. ICD shocks can occur at end of life (EOL) and cause substantial distress, warranting consideration of ICD deactivation discussions. This nationwide physician survey sought to (1) determine if physicians discuss ICD deactivation at the EOL, (2) identify predictors of those discussions, and (3) ascertain physicians' knowledge/attitudes about ICD use. METHODS We surveyed 4,876 physicians stratified by specialty (cardiologists, electrophysiologists, general internists, and geriatricians). The mailed survey presented 5 vignettes (eg, end-stage chronic obstructive pulmonary disease, advanced dementia) wherein ICD deactivation might be considered and 17 Likert-scaled items. RESULTS Five hundred fifty-eight (12%) physicians returned surveys. Respondents were largely men (77%) and white (69%). Most physicians (56%-83%) said they would initiate deactivation discussions in all 5 vignettes, whereas significantly more (82%-94%) would discuss advance directives and do not resuscitate status. In logistic regression analyses, a history of prior deactivation discussions was an independent predictor of willingness to discuss deactivation (adjusted OR range, 2.8-8.8) in 4 of the 5 vignettes. General internists and geriatricians were less likely than electrophysiologists to agree that ICD shocks are painful and to distinguish between the ICD's pacing and defibrillator functions. Finally, most physicians believed that informed consent for ICD implantation should include information about deactivation (77%) and endorsed the need for expert guidance in this area (58%). CONCLUSIONS Most physicians would discuss ICD deactivation at EOL. The strongest predictor of this was a history of prior discussions. Knowledge about ICDs varies by specialty, and most expressed a desire for more expert guidance about ICD management at EOL.

Abstract
During the past 2 years the number of studies examining psychopathology and quality of life after ICD implantation has increased dramatically. Variables assessed have included recipient age, gender, and social support network. How recipients respond to having the device, particularly after experiencing firing, has been evaluated in light of new depression and anxiety disorder diagnoses as well as premorbid personality structure. Now the picture of what is known is, if anything, cloudier than it was 2 years ago, with little definitive and much contradictory data emerging in most of these categories. It still seems clear that in a significant minority of ICD recipients the device negatively affects quality of life, probably more so if it fires. Education about life with the device before receiving it remains paramount. Reports continue to appear of patients developing new-onset diagnosable anxiety disorders such as panic and posttraumatic stress disorder. Until recently the strongest predictors of induced psychopathology were considered to be the frequency and recency of device firing. It now seems that preimplantation psychologic variables such as degree of optimism or pessimism and an anxious personality style may confer an even greater risk than previously thought. Certainly many variables factor into the induction of psychopathology in these patients. Among these factors are age, gender, and perception of control of shocks, as well as the predictability of shocks and psychologic attributions made by the patient regarding the device. Another source of variability is this population's medical heterogeneity. Some patients receive ICDs after near-death experiences; others get them as anticipatory prophylaxis. Some have longstanding and entrenched heart disease; others were apparently healthy before sudden dangerous arrhythmias. Diagnoses as diverse as myocardial infarction in the context of advanced coronary artery disease and dilated cardiomyopathy after acute viral infection may warrant ICD placement. Moreover the course of cardiac disease after ICD placement may vary from relative stability to continuing disease progression and severe functional compromise. Unless these and other pre- and postimplantation differences are taken into account, it is almost impossible to make meaningful comparisons between studies. Ideally, future research would consist either of large-scale, randomized, prospective studies using validated structured-interview tools to supplement a literature dominated by self-report measures, unstructured assessments, and anecdotal reports, or of smaller studies designed to focus on particular diagnostic subsets. As ICDs become the standard of care for potentially life-threatening arrhythmias, the rate of implantations continues to increase. Because negative emotions have been linked to an increased incidence of arrhythmias, and untreated or unrecognized psychiatric illness can interfere with adaptation to an ICD, assessing and managing both pre-existing and induced psychiatric disorders becomes even more critical. Greater research attention should be paid to determining which patients meet criteria for anxiety disorders before and after implantation and what premorbid traits predispose to postimplantation psychopathology. The authors predict that psychiatrists will be involved increasingly in caring for this population, offering insights into treatment options that increase the likelihood of successful ICD acceptance and decrease the psychosocial costs of these devices.

Abstract
OBJECTIVE Several investigations have found that anxiety disorders often develop in patients with an implantable cardioverter-defibrillator (ICD). This study investigated the inter--and intraindividual stability of anxiety and its relation to ICD activity in patients with an ICD. METHODS Changes in the psychopathology of 35 patients with an ICD were assessed at the beginning of the trial period and 2.5 years later. Psychometric measures of anxiety were collected. During this period, shocks and antitachycardia pacing were assessed. RESULTS Anxiety was found to be interindividually stable. We also found a slight, but statistically significant, reduction in trait anxiety and avoidance behavior over time. Patients who experienced shocks or antitachycardia pacing did not differ on psychometric or demographic variables from patients without those events. CONCLUSIONS Anxiety seems to be interindividually stable in patients with an ICD. We found no connection between anxiety and tachycardia episodes in patients with an ICD.

Abstract
AIMS Previous studies have raised concerns about high levels of anxiety and depression in implanted cardioverter-defibrillator patients, and suggested that adverse psychological outcomes have been related to delivered therapy, age, and gender. This study aimed to assess the prevalence of anxiety and depression and to analyse quality-of-life in a New Zealand patient group. METHODS AND RESULTS We questioned 46 ICD and 49 pacemaker patients regarding device and treatment satisfaction, depression, anxiety (Hospital Anxiety and Depression Scale), and quality-of-life (SF 36). The prevalence of clinical depression and anxiety in the ICD group was 7 and 13%, respectively, and did not differ from the pacemaker group. ICD patients mean anxiety and depression scores did not differ from the pacemaker group, although more ICD patients had subclinical levels of anxiety. Quality-of-life scores were normal for all ICD patients with respect to both mental and physical component scores, and not different from the pacemaker group. Anxiety, depression, and quality-of-life scores were unrelated to time from implantation, delivered therapy, age, or gender. Overall, 93% of the ICD patients thought their device was worthwhile. CONCLUSION We found a lower than expected level of anxiety and depression in ICD patients, and suggest that this may be due in part to the small team approach adopted locally in the follow-up of this patient group.

Abstract
BACKGROUND Multiple clinical trials have shown that a properly functioning implantable cardioverter-defibrillator (ICD) is capable of interrupting sudden death caused by ventricular tachyarrhythmias. However, ICDs are complex medical devices, and they do not always perform as expected or they may fail completely. Exposure of ICD recipients to professional or media reports that their specific device type is potentially malfunctioning could negatively influence their psychological status. METHODS This study aimed to evaluate and quantify psychological distress in patients implanted with an ICD-recall device. Thirty patients implanted with ICD-recall devices (ICD-recall group) and 25 patients with unaffected ICD devices (ICD-control group) were interviewed using the Brief Symptom Inventory (a psychological self-report symptom scale). RESULTS Mean values of all primary psychiatric distress symptom dimensions and global indices were within the normal range for both the ICD-recall and the ICD-control group. New York Heart Association (NYHA)class was a predictor of higher distress symptoms in all categories, independently of the ICD group. NYHA II group patients tended toward higher stress levels than the NYHA I group, but only somatization was significantly different. An upward, but not significant, trend in 7 of the 12 scales was associated with symptomatic shock experience. CONCLUSION This study demonstrates that psychological distress was not significantly increased in patients recently informed about a potential malfunction of their device.
